["Generously grease Bundt pan.", "In plastic bag put mixture of sugar and cinnamon.", "Cut biscuits, one can at a time, into quarters and shake in plastic bag with sugar and cinnamon to coat.", "Place these pieces in Bundt pan.", "Melt 15 tablespoons butter; mix in white and brown sugars and heat until melted.", "Pour 1/4 of this mixture over first can of biscuits.", "Repeat this procedure, alternating sugar and butter mixture and biscuit quarters until gone.", "Bake 40 to 45 minutes at 350u00b0.", "Turn pan over onto plate as soon as removed from oven.", "Do not remove pan for 15 minutes. Serve warm or cold.", "Just ""pluck"" off a piece with your fingers."]
